Abstract:
A semiconductor memory device includes a normal memory block including a plurality of normal memory cells, a redundant memory block including a plurality of redundant memory cells used to replace defective cells among the normal memory cells, a normal buffer block configured to sense and amplify data stored in the normal memory block, a redundant buffer block configured to sense and amplify data stored in the redundant memory block, a normal latch block configured to fetch data from the normal buffer block and store the data based on a normal control signal, and a redundant latch block configured to selectively fetch data from the redundant buffer block and store the data based on a redundant control signal.
Abstract:
A method for sharing data in a transmitting-side electronic device communicating with a receiving-side electronic device is provided. The method includes connecting a voice call with the receiving-side electronic device; obtaining a sharing object to be shared with the receiving-side electronic device; and transmitting data corresponding to the sharing object to the receiving-side electronic device through a data session formed based on information related to the voice call.

Abstract:
An electronic device and method for controlling an external device using a number are provided. The electronic device includes a processor configured to transmit an input number to a server over a mobile network, in response to a connection being input, receive an identifier of the external device, which is issued by the server, send a connection request to the external device over the mobile network using the received identifier of the external device, and control the external device by sending a control command to the external device, in response to receiving an indication regarding completion of access authentication from the external device, and a communication interface configured to perform communication with the external device and the server.
